Official Finland visa photo dimensions

Finnish visa photo requirements specify photos must be exactly 35 mm wide and 45 mm high. Your face from the bottom of the chin to the top of the head (crown) must occupy between 70% and 80% of the total photo height (31–36 mm).

Finland visa photo size in mm, cm, and inches

UnitWidthHeightFace height
Millimetres (mm)35 mm45 mm31 – 36 mm
Centimetres (cm)3.5 cm4.5 cm3.1–3.6 cm
Inches (in)1.38 in1.77 in1.24–1.42 in
Pixels (px @ 300 DPI)413 px531 px372–425 px

How to take a Finland visa photo at home

How to take a Finland visa photo at home
01

Set up a light grey, cream, or white background

Stand or sit in front of a plain, uniformly coloured wall or surface that is light grey, cream, or white. The background must be shadow-free with no patterns, textures, folds, or objects. A light grey background is the standard Schengen recommendation and helps prevent overexposure.

02

Set up balanced, diffused lighting

Use natural daylight from a large window, or two balanced artificial lights at equal height and distance on either side of your face. Avoid direct flash, which creates harsh highlights, red-eye, and shadows. Soft, even lighting is crucial for a uniform background and a well-lit face without shadows.

03

Position your head and body correctly

Face the camera directly with your head level and upright — not tilted, not turned. Your chin should be neither raised nor lowered. Both sides of your face should be equally visible. Your shoulders and the base of your neck should appear at the bottom of the frame. Position yourself approximately 45–60 cm from the camera.

04

Take the photo

Open your eyes fully and look directly into the lens. Keep a neutral expression with your mouth closed — no smiling, frowning, or raised eyebrows. If you wear glasses, consider removing them to avoid glare, or ensure they have thin frames and tilt them slightly to prevent reflections. Ask someone else to take the photo for better framing.

05

Crop and size the image

For paper submissions, crop to exactly 35 × 45 mm at 300 DPI minimum, ensuring the face occupies 70–80% of the height. For online submissions (Enter Finland portal), ensure the image is between 10 KB and 2 MB. Resize or compress the image if necessary to meet the file size limits.

06

Check before submitting

Verify the background is plain light grey, cream, or white and shadow-free, your expression is neutral, eyes are fully open, the face occupies 70–80% of the frame, hair does not obscure the face, there is no glare on glasses, and the file size is between 10 KB and 2 MB.

Common Finland visa photo rejection reasons

Common Finland visa photo rejection reasons

Incorrect background colour or shadows

Finland requires a plain light grey, cream, or white background for Schengen visa photos. Dark, coloured, patterned backgrounds or the presence of any shadows on the background or face will lead to rejection. Ensure even, shadow-free lighting on a uniform surface.

Non-neutral expression or head position

Smiling, open mouth, tilted head, head turned to the side, raised eyebrows, or partially closed eyes are detected by biometric checks. Your head must be level and upright, facing the camera directly with a neutral expression and mouth closed.

Face proportion out of range

Your face from chin to crown must occupy 70–80% of the 45 mm photo height (approximately 30–36 mm). If your face is too small or too large, it will fail the automated proportion check.

Insufficient resolution or file size

Finnish visa applications require a JPEG file between 10 KB and 2 MB. Files that are smaller than this will be rejected for low quality.

Glasses causing glare or with thick frames

While glasses are permitted, they frequently cause rejection if the frames are too thick or if there is glare, reflections, or shadows from the lenses on the face or eyes. It is often safer to remove glasses for the photo.

Scan of a printed photo

Uploading a scanned version of a printed photo, or a mobile phone photo taken of another photo, will fail quality checks. The digital file must be the original camera capture, not a reproduction.

Photo older than 6 months

The photo must be recent (taken within the last 6 months) and reflect your current appearance. Older photos will be rejected during processing.

Hair or accessories obscuring the face

Hair covering the forehead, eyebrows, or eyes, and large earrings or accessories casting shadows on the face, are common causes of rejection. Pull hair back fully so the entire face is clearly visible.

Frequently asked questions: Finland visa photo 2026

What is the Finland visa photo size requirement in 2026?

Finland Schengen visa photos must be 35 mm wide by 45 mm high. Your face from chin to crown must occupy 70 to 80 percent of the photo height (approx. 31–36 mm). The background must be plain light grey, cream, or white. For online applications submitted through the Enter Finland portal, upload a JPEG file between 10 KB and 2 MB.

What is the Finland visa photo size in pixels?

The Enter Finland portal does not specify a fixed minimum pixel count, but a resolution of at least 600 × 800 pixels is recommended to pass automated quality checks. Aim for 900 × 1200 pixels or higher for best results, ensuring the JPEG file stays between 10 KB and 2 MB.

What is the Finland visa photo size in cm and inches?

The photo must be 3.5 cm wide by 4.5 cm high. In inches, that is approximately 1.38 inches wide by 1.77 inches high. This follows the standard European Schengen format.

What colour must the background be for a Finland visa photo?

The background must be plain and uniform. Acceptable colours are light grey, cream, or white. It must be shadow-free with no patterns or textures. A plain light grey background is the standard Schengen requirement and is strongly recommended.

Can I wear glasses in a Finland visa photo?

Yes, glasses are permitted for Finland/Schengen visa photos, but with strict conditions. Frames must be thin and not cover any part of the eyes. Lenses must be completely glare-free with no reflections. Due to these strict rules, it is often recommended to remove glasses to avoid rejection.

Can I smile in a Finland visa photo?

No. You must maintain a neutral expression with your mouth closed and eyes fully open. Smiling, frowning, raised eyebrows, head tilt, and any non-neutral expression will be detected by biometric processing and will cause your photo to be rejected.

How recent must a Finland visa photo be?

The photo must have been taken within the last 6 months and must accurately reflect your current appearance. Photos that are older or that do not match your current look will be rejected.

What is the file size limit for Finland visa online photo upload?

The Enter Finland online portal requires a JPEG file between 10 KB and 2 MB. Files under 10 KB are too small and will be rejected for poor quality. Files over 2 MB must be compressed or resized before uploading.

Are Finland tourist visa and student visa photo requirements different?

No. The same 35 × 45 mm Schengen specification and biometric requirements apply across all short-stay Schengen visa categories for Finland, including tourist, business, and visitor visas. Always check the specific documentation checklist for your visa type on the official Migri (Finnish Immigration Service) website.

Can I retouch or edit my Finland visa photo?

No. Any form of digital retouching or editing is prohibited. This includes skin smoothing, blemish removal, background replacement, and brightness or contrast adjustments. The submitted file must be the original, unaltered digital capture.

What should I wear for a Finland visa photo?

Wear everyday clothing that clearly contrasts with the light grey, cream, or white background. Avoid light-coloured tops that blend in. Do not wear uniforms, costumes, or anything that obscures the face or neck. Religious dress is permitted if the full face remains visible.

Are religious head coverings allowed in a Finland visa photo?

Yes, provided the covering is worn daily for religious reasons and your full face from chin to crown remains clearly visible. The covering must not cast shadows on your face or background, and the side edges of your face (including the outer eye corners) must be visible.

What are the Finland visa photo requirements for babies and children?

Children of all ages, including newborns, must have their own separate visa photo. For infants who cannot support their head, lay them on a plain light grey, cream, or white sheet and photograph from above. All standard requirements apply, with some flexibility on expression for very young infants.

Should a Finland visa photo be matte or glossy?

For paper submissions, either matte or glossy photo paper is acceptable. For digital submissions via the Enter Finland portal, paper finish is irrelevant. Ensure printed photos are on high-quality photo paper.

Can I use a photo taken on my phone for a Finland visa?

Yes, provided the photo meets all requirements: plain light grey/cream/white background, neutral expression, face occupying 70–80% of the frame, JPEG format between 10 KB and 2 MB. Have a second person take the photo rather than using a selfie. Reduce the file size before uploading if necessary.

Is Finland part of the Schengen Area for visa purposes?

Yes, Finland is a full member of the Schengen Area. Finnish visa photo requirements follow the standard Schengen format (35×45 mm, face 70-80%, neutral expression, light grey/cream/white background). A Finnish short-stay visa (Schengen visa) allows travel within the entire Schengen Area.
